Дистрибуция и внедрение инновационных продуктов и решений для корпоративного сектора от лидеров мирового ИТ-рынка

Informatica PowerCenter Developer Level I

Слушатели получат знания и навыки, необходимые для начала самостоятельной работы с продуктом Informatica PowerCenter. Материал курса построен на основании уникальных материалов и методик разработанных вендором.

В курсе рассмотрены необходимые теоретические знания по продукту, а так же разработан набор лабораторных работ, помогающих ученику лучше понять принципы работы продукта.

Курс, в первую очередь, будет интересен следующим категориям специалистов:

  •  разработчикам, непосредственно работающим с продуктом Informatica PowerCenter;
  • системным аналитикам и руководителям проектов, участвующим в проектах и использующих ETL продукты;
  • кроме того, к дополнительной целевой аудитории также относятся квалифицированные специалисты, желающие понять суть работы ETL систем и желающие повысить свой профессиональный уровень.

Продолжительность учебного курса составляет 4 дня (32 академических часа)

Каждый посетитель семинара  должен иметь при себе ноутбук следующей конфигурации:

  • современный процессор (core i3, i5, i7);
  • объем оперативной памяти не меньше 4 Гбайт;
  • размер свободного места на жестком диске (на одном разделе) не меньше 10 Гбайт;
  • мышь;
  • установленная операционная система Windows XP (Professional)/7 (Professional, Ultimate) ;
  • языковые настройки операционной системы русские;
  • машина должна иметь права локального администратора;
  • установленный web-браузер (Internet Explorer 9 и выше, Google Chrome 35.x) ;
  • желательно наличие любого SQL средства для выполнение запросов на БД (Oracle).

 

Программа обучения по курсу 

Informatica PowerCenter Developer Level I

 

  1. Концепция интеграции данных

 

     2. Компоненты PowerCenter и пользовательский интерфейс

  • Лабораторная работа: Использование Designer и Workflow Manager  

 

     3. Трансформация Source Qualifier

  • Лабораторная работа A: Загрузка таблицы Payment Staging 
  • Лабораторная работа B: Загрузка таблицы Product Staging  
  • Лабораторная работа C: Загрузка таблиц Dealership and Promotions Staging 

 

    4. Трансформации Expression, Filter, работа со списками файлов File Lists и планировщиком Workflow Scheduler

 

    5. Работа с Join-трансформациями, Техника и возможности работы с интерфейсом.

  • Лабораторная работа A: Загрузка таблицы Sales Transaction Staging 
  • Лабораторная работа B: Техника и возможности работы с интерфейсом. 

 

    6. Lookup-трансформации и повторно-используемые (Reusable) трансформации

  • Лабораторная работа A: Загрузка таблицы Employee Staging Table 
  • Лабораторная работа B: Загрузка таблицы Date Staging Table  

 

    7. Средства отладки (Debugger)

  • Лабораторная работа: Использование Debugger  

 

    8. Трансформация Sequence Generator

  • Лабораторная работа: Загрузка таблицы измерений Date Dimension 

 

    9. Работа с кэшем Lookup-трансформаций. Расширенные возможности работы с интерфейсом

  • Лабораторная работа A: Загрузка таблицы измерений Promotions Dimension (Lookup и Persistent Cache). 
  • Лабораторная работа B: Расширенные возможности работы с интерфейсом 

 

   10.  Трансформации Sorter, Aggregator. Работа с Self-Join

  • Лабораторная работа: Перезагрузка таблицы Employee Staging 

 

   11.  Трансформации Router и Update Strategy. Использование Overrides

  • Лабораторная работа: Загрузка таблицы измерений Employee Dimension 

 

   12.  Работа с Dynamic Lookup и журналирование ошибок (Error Logging)

  • Лабораторная работа: Загрузка таблицы измерений Customer Dimension 

 

   13.  Работа с Unconnected Lookup, Использование параметров и переменных (Parameters and Variables).

  • Лабораторная работа: Загрузка таблицы фактов Sales Fact  

 

   14.  Работа с мапплетами (Mapplets)

  • Лабораторная работа: Создание мапплетов

 

   15.  Проектирование маппингов (Mapping Design)

  • Лабораторная работа: Загрузка Promotions Daily Aggregate Table 

 

   16.  Работа с процессами (Workflow). Использование переменных  и задач (Variables and Tasks)

  • Лабораторная работа: Загрузка Product Weekly Aggregate Table

 

   17.  Работа с различными задачами в рамках Workflow. Концепция повторного использования логики (Reusability)

 

   18.  Работа с ворклетами (Worklets). Работа с различными задачами в рамках Workflow

  • Лабораторная работа: Загрузка Inventory Fact Table  

 

   19.  Проектирование процессов (Workflow Design)